Output d67b56bac68177e92f08c5627a8a677c344b11a65fd0296ee92daefbe4da7966:26

value
42448484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ee4bc1fcd3a52112c82bfd58e3b5b788023762a OP_EQUAL
address
MDdi96mwi978SRpDwBLAN19dPC5aJDwahC
transaction
d67b56bac68177e92f08c5627a8a677c344b11a65fd0296ee92daefbe4da7966
spent
true